**Ticket: Config drift on BounceSift processor**

The email bounce processor in the Larkfield environment has drifted from the values committed in the release branch. Retry windows and suppression thresholds no longer match, which likely explains the duplicate suppression entries reported Tuesday. Please reconcile before the Thursday cut. For reference, the currently deployed configuration on the live node reads as follows.

config for yajep-yahof:
[briax]
port = 9200
region = outer-2
host = briax.nelvrocorp.test
team = raleth
timeout_ms = 1500
retries = 1

# Currency Conversion Store

Historical rounding discrepancies from the Quillrate converter are logged to the `fx_residuals` table, one row per settlement batch. Residuals are reconciled monthly; do not truncate this table. All conversion math uses banker's rounding since release 2.4. The residuals database is accessed with the connection string below.

primary connection of yagep-kahip = redis://giliel_svc:zYiKsLL2PLpfPL@db-348f.xolmarsys.corp:5432/fenwyn

## Formula sandbox tuning

User-supplied formulas in Gridmoor execute inside a restricted interpreter with hard ceilings on time, memory, and call depth. Reviewers should confirm any change to these ceilings is justified in the PR description, since raising them widens the abuse surface. Defaults were chosen from production traces. The current limits are as follows.

limits module of tafog-fawip:
WEIGHTS = {
    "julix": 57,
    "lamys": 992,
    "kasvan": 209,
    "quenok": 750,
    "alddor": 259,
    "oliath": 1009,
    "wenix": 815,
}